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2007.11.11;
Скачать: CL | DM;

Вниз

Сообщения MSSQL   Найти похожие ветки 

 
Zik   (2007-07-03 10:51) [0]

Добрый день.
На сервере есть написаные харнимые процедуры. Они выполняются последовательно, т.е. одна запускает другую. Каждая процедура выдает сообщения PRINT в процессе выполнения. Как получить с сервера эти сообщения?


 
MsGuns ©   (2007-07-03 12:11) [1]

RecordSet


 
sniknik ©   (2007-07-03 12:29) [2]

> выдает сообщения PRINT
PRINT это сообщение об ошибке с низким приоритетом, т.что "ловить" эти сообщения нужно в коллекции ошибок у коннекта.
правда нужно еще позаботится о том чтобы получать все рекордсеты списка (для каждого своя коллекция. пустые, без даных, ADODataSet отсекает, т.е. надо разбирать самому), ну и плюс надо пользоваться серверным курсором (тоже дополнительные проблемы добавляет) т.к. при клиентском "пустышки" отсекаются еще сервером.

в общем подумай, надо ли тебе это? и не проще ди заменить логику, чем делать заведомо "кривую" реализацию?


 
Zik   (2007-07-04 09:57) [3]

Тогда поправте меня. Как лучше реализовать?


 
ЮЮ ©   (2007-07-05 04:51) [4]

> Тогда поправте меня. Как лучше реализовать?

Что реализовать? Ты хочешь, чтобы клиент получил лог выполненных действий? Разве клиенту недостаточно знать, что процедура выполнилась успешно?



Страницы: 1 вся ветка

Текущий архив: 2007.11.11;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.019 c
3-1183445482
Zik
2007-07-03 10:51
2007.11.11
Сообщения MSSQL


9-1162945673
cxvxc
2006-11-08 03:27
2007.11.11
Спрайт OpenGL


3-1183376487
Zik
2007-07-02 15:41
2007.11.11
Список SQL серверов


2-1192983475
saymon
2007-10-21 20:17
2007.11.11
key violation


15-1192010817
Nic
2007-10-10 14:06
2007.11.11
IE и запоминание пароля